Automated Edge Banding Systems

Modern cabinetry production has largely embraced machine edge banding processes to significantly enhance productivity and quality. These sophisticated solutions utilize robotic mechanisms and accurate governance to apply facing materials—such as melamine—to panel borders. The process, which historically was manual, now boasts reduced supply loss, even adhesion, and a dramatically higher yield pace. Furthermore, sophisticated edge banding machines can often integrate multiple finishing procedures and handle a wider range of resources with impressive versatility.

Edge Device Maintenance & Troubleshooting

Regular service is absolutely vital for ensuring the duration and peak functionality of your facing machine. Ignoring scheduled reviews can lead to expensive breakdowns and protracted downtime. A proactive approach involves periodic purging of dust and debris, oiling moving parts, and checking belts for damage. Frequent repairs often include replacing used cylinders, tuning the force, and resolving any motor difficulties. Consider consulting the producer’s manual for specific advice and problem-solving assistance. A well-maintained facing device not only generates premium results but also protects your resource.
